Board support library for C027

Dependents:   IoTWorkshopLCD IoTWorkshopBuzzer IoTWorkshopSensors C027_USSDTest ... more

Fork of C027 by u-blox

/media/uploads/ublox/c027_pinout_new.png

Revision:
8:a356376db984
Parent:
7:e3eab86f1de9
Child:
13:fb30e9923a7b
--- a/C027.h	Fri Oct 25 08:46:43 2013 +0000
+++ b/C027.h	Tue Nov 05 21:41:46 2013 +0000
@@ -22,21 +22,22 @@
 
     void mdmPower(bool enable);
     void mdmReset(void);
+    void mdmWakeup(void);
+    void mdmSleep(void);
     void gpsPower(bool enable);
     void gpsReset(void);
 
 private:
     // modem pins 
-    DigitalOut mdmEn;
-#ifndef C027_REVA
-    DigitalOut mdmRst;
-#endif
-    DigitalOut mdmPwrOn;
-    DigitalOut mdmRts;
-    bool mdmIsEnabled;
+    DigitalOut      mdmEn;
+    DigitalOut      mdmRst;
+    DigitalOut      mdmPwrOn;
+    DigitalOut      mdmRts;
+    DigitalOut      mdmLvlOe;
+    DigitalOut      mdmUsbDet;
+    bool            mdmIsEnabled;
     // gps pins
-    DigitalOut gpsEn;
-    DigitalOut gpsRst;
-    bool gpsIsEnabled;
+    DigitalOut      gpsEn;
+    DigitalOut      gpsRst;
+    bool            gpsIsEnabled;
 };
-